To begin with this recipe, we have to first prepare a few components. You can cook sticky date pudding with butterscotch sauce using 12 ingredients and 7 steps. Here is how you cook that.
The ingredients needed to make Sticky date pudding with butterscotch sauce:
- Make ready Pudding
- Take 180 grams Dates
- Make ready 1 1/4 cup Water
- Prepare 1/2 tsp Baking soda
- Get 3/4 cup Brown sugar
- Get 60 grams Butter
- Prepare 2 Eggs
- Take 1 cup Self raising flour
- Take Sauce
- Take 1/2 cup Brown sugar
- Take 25 grams Butter
- Get 100 ml Cream

Instructions to make Sticky date pudding with butterscotch sauce:
- Put the dates and water in a pot and boil, add the baking soda and stir until the dates start to break up. Set aside to cool.
- Heat oven to 180C. Grease 10 muffin tins.
- Cream butter and Brown sugar, add the eggs one at a time, add the cooled date mixture and fold in the self raising flour.
- Spoon into muffin tins and bake until cooked. (approx 15mins)
- In another pot add the butter and brown sugar, boil, then add cream and continue to boil till the sauce is golden brown and thick.
- Serve the sauce on top of your pudding with cream or ice cream
